Understanding Hyperhidrosis and Its Impact
Hyperhidrosis is a medical condition characterized by excessive sweating beyond what the body needs for temperature regulation. Unlike normal sweating triggered by heat or exercise, hyperhidrosis causes uncontrollable sweat production in areas like the palms, feet, underarms, and face. This condition can disrupt daily life, leading to discomfort, social anxiety, and even skin infections due to constant moisture.
The exact cause of primary hyperhidrosis remains unclear but is thought to involve overactive sweat glands controlled by the sympathetic nervous system. Secondary hyperhidrosis, on the other hand, results from underlying health issues such as thyroid problems, diabetes, or infections. Identifying whether sweating is primary or secondary is critical because it influences treatment strategies.

Topical Treatments: The First Line of Defense
For many people struggling with hyperhidrosis, starting with topical treatments makes sense. Over-the-counter antiperspirants containing aluminum chloride are widely recommended because they temporarily block sweat ducts, reducing perspiration on the skin’s surface.
How these antiperspirants work: Aluminum chloride reacts with sweat to form a gel-like plug inside sweat ducts. This plug prevents sweat from reaching the skin temporarily until the plug naturally sheds off.
Prescription-strength antiperspirants like aluminum chloride hexahydrate (20% concentration) are more potent than regular deodorants and should be applied at night when sweat glands are less active. Consistent use over weeks provides noticeable improvement in sweating control.
However, some users experience skin irritation or itching due to the high concentration of aluminum compounds. To minimize this risk:
- Apply on dry skin only.
- Avoid shaving immediately before application.
- Use moisturizers if irritation occurs.
While topical treatments are convenient and non-invasive, they may not fully eliminate excessive sweating in severe cases but serve as an effective starting point.
Oral Medications for Systemic Control
When topical options don’t cut it, doctors may prescribe oral medications that reduce sweating by blocking nerve signals responsible for activating sweat glands.
Anticholinergic drugs such as glycopyrrolate and oxybutynin are commonly used to treat hyperhidrosis. These medications inhibit acetylcholine receptors involved in stimulating sweat production.
While effective for many patients, oral anticholinergics come with side effects that require careful consideration:
- Dry mouth
- Blurred vision
- Constipation
- Dizziness
Because of these possible adverse reactions, dosage must be tailored individually under medical supervision. These drugs are especially useful for widespread sweating where topical treatments don’t reach all affected areas.
Other medications sometimes prescribed include beta-blockers or benzodiazepines if anxiety triggers sweating episodes; however, these do not target sweat glands directly.
Botox Injections: Targeted Sweat Gland Paralysis
Botulinum toxin type A (Botox) injections have revolutionized hyperhidrosis treatment by offering precise control over problematic areas like underarms and palms.
Botox works by blocking the release of acetylcholine at nerve endings near sweat glands. Without this chemical messenger, sweat glands become inactive temporarily—usually lasting between 4 to 12 months depending on individual response.
The procedure involves multiple small injections administered in a grid pattern across the sweaty region. Though mildly uncomfortable during administration, Botox provides dramatic relief for many patients who see a reduction in sweating of up to 90%.
Side effects are minimal but can include:
- Mild pain or bruising at injection sites
- Temporary muscle weakness near treated areas (rare)
Botox is FDA-approved specifically for axillary (underarm) hyperhidrosis but is also used off-label for palms and feet by experienced providers.

Surgical Options: Permanent Solutions For Severe Cases
Surgery is typically reserved for severe hyperhidrosis cases that do not respond well to conservative measures. Several surgical techniques exist:
Endoscopic Thoracic Sympathectomy (ETS)
ETS involves cutting or clamping sympathetic nerves responsible for triggering excessive sweating in targeted areas like hands or face. This minimally invasive procedure uses small incisions and a camera inserted into the chest cavity.
While ETS often results in permanent reduction of sweating at treated sites, it carries risks such as compensatory sweating where other body parts begin to sweat more intensely after surgery—a trade-off some patients find unacceptable.
Sweat Gland Removal Techniques
In axillary hyperhidrosis cases unresponsive to other treatments:
- Liposuction-assisted removal targets sweat glands beneath the skin.
- Surgical excision removes portions of skin rich in sweat glands.
These approaches physically reduce the number of active sweat glands but require recovery time and carry risks of scarring or infection.
Lifestyle Adjustments That Help Control Sweating
Beyond medical interventions, certain lifestyle choices can help reduce episodes of excessive sweating:
- Dress smartly: Choose breathable fabrics like cotton or moisture-wicking materials that help keep skin dry.
- Avoid triggers: Spicy foods, caffeine, alcohol, and stress often worsen sweating.
- Maintain good hygiene: Frequent washing reduces bacteria buildup that causes odor linked with sweat.
- Stay hydrated: Drinking water helps regulate body temperature effectively.
- Mental relaxation techniques: Practices like meditation or deep breathing can lower stress-induced sweats.
These adjustments alone won’t cure hyperhidrosis but complement medical treatments well by minimizing flare-ups.

The Role of Diagnosis Before Treatment Begins
Proper diagnosis is crucial before deciding how to get rid of hyperhidrosis effectively. Doctors typically perform a physical exam along with detailed patient history focusing on:
- Sweat patterns—areas affected and severity.
- Disease onset—age when symptoms started and progression timeline.
- Possible secondary causes—checking for thyroid disorders or infections via blood tests if necessary.
- The impact on quality of life—how much daily activities are disrupted by symptoms.
In some cases, specialized tests like starch-iodine test or gravimetric measurement quantify sweat production precisely. Accurate diagnosis helps tailor treatment plans ensuring better outcomes without unnecessary interventions.
Tackling Emotional Challenges Linked With Hyperhidrosis
Excessive sweating often takes an emotional toll causing embarrassment and social withdrawal. Many sufferers report feeling anxious about shaking hands or visible wet patches on clothing during important meetings or social gatherings.
Addressing mental well-being alongside physical symptoms improves overall quality of life dramatically. Support groups or counseling sessions encourage sharing experiences and coping strategies while boosting confidence levels through education about available treatments.
Understanding that hyperhidrosis is a medical condition—not a personal flaw—helps reduce stigma attached to it. Empowerment through knowledge motivates patients to seek timely help rather than suffer silently.
